Abstract

The utility model provide a kind of have on highway, monitor driving vehicle and whether exceed the speed limit, the expressway safety supervising device of overload, comprising: road safety detection module and monitoring module; Described road safety detection module comprises: camera collection module, and GPS speed measuring module, with described camera collection module, the collection signal processing module that GPS speed measuring module connects respectively, and, the wireless sending module being connected with described collection signal processing module; Described monitoring module comprises: wireless receiving module, and the reception signal processing module being connected with described reception of wireless signals module, the display module being connected with described reception signal processing module, and, the data storage server being connected with display module.

Description

A kind of expressway safety supervising device
[technical field]
The utility model relates to a kind of expressway safety supervising device.
[background technology]
Traffic accidents frequently occurs at present on highway, and safety coefficient can not get ensureing, lacks a kind of traffic safety supervising device that integrates hypervelocity overload detection on existing market.
[summary of the invention]
Technical problem to be solved in the utility model is to provide and can directly realizes the expressway safety supervising device that hypervelocity overload detects simultaneously, be convenient to the security information that staff understands highway driving vehicle more effectively, stop in time unsafe driving vehicle, to reduce traffic safety hidden danger.
The purpose of this utility model realizes by technical scheme once:
An expressway safety supervising device, is characterized in that, comprising: road safety detection module and monitoring module; Described road safety detection module comprises: camera collection module, and GPS speed measuring module, with described camera collection module, the collection signal processing module that GPS speed measuring module connects respectively, and, the wireless sending module being connected with described collection signal processing module; Described monitoring module comprises: wireless receiving module, and the reception signal processing module being connected with described reception of wireless signals module, the display module being connected with described reception signal processing module, and, the data storage server being connected with display module.
Preferably, described camera collection module adopts dynamic camera.
Preferably, the mode of operation of described wireless sending module and wireless receiving module is set to signal transmitting and receiving pattern.
Preferably, the GPS mode of operation of described GPS speed measuring module is set to the pattern of testing the speed.
Adopt technique scheme, can strengthen the security information of running on expressway automobile to carry out omnibearing detection.
Compared with prior art the utility model has the advantage of, omnibearing collection road driving vehicle safety travel information, as whether exceeded the speed limit, overload, improve the supervision of traffic department to mechanical transport, understand in time and stop unsafe running car on road, thus the generation of reduction road driving automobile safety accident.
[accompanying drawing explanation]
Fig. 1 is the structural representation of the embodiment of the utility model expressway safety supervising device.
[embodiment]
Below in conjunction with accompanying drawing and preferred embodiment, the utility model is described further.
Expressway safety supervising device as described in Figure 1, comprising: road safety detection module 100 and monitoring module 200; Described road safety detection module 100 comprises: camera collection module 110, GPS speed measuring module 120, with described camera collection module 110, the collection signal processing module 130 that GPS speed measuring module 120 connects respectively, and, with the wireless sending module 140 that described collection signal processing module 130 is connected, road safety information; Described monitoring module 200 comprises: wireless receiving module 210, the reception signal processing module 220 being connected with described signal receiving module 210, the display module 230 being connected with described reception signal processing module, and, the data storage server 240 being connected with display module 230.
Described camera collection module 110 adopts dynamic camera.
Described wireless sending module 140 and the mode of operation of wireless receiving module 210 are set to signal transmitting and receiving pattern.
The GPS mode of operation of described GPS speed measuring module 120 is set to the pattern of testing the speed.
